Your diet and lifestyle are the major factors affecting your skin. Let us know the 10 superfoods that can make our skin radiant. 


1- Tomato- Tomatoes are a great option to get healthy and beautiful skin. Including one tomato in your daily diet will give the body a good amount of vitamin A, vitamin C and potassium. Be sure to include tomatoes in the diet for a glowing skin. 


2- Green vegetables- Green vegetables are very beneficial for your health. You must include spinach in your diet. Spinach helps us recover from fatigue, make up for sleep deprivation, relieves the problem of anemia and dark circles. Spinach gives the body a plenty of iron, vitamin K and C. 


3- Nuts and seeds- You must include nuts and seeds in your food for getting a healthy skin. You should include almonds, cashew nuts, raisins and walnuts in your diet. Along with that flax seeds, pumpkin seeds and chia seeds should also be included in your diet. They provide with vitamin E, which maintains the level of moisture in the skin. Helps in keeping skin soft and hydrated. 


4- Whole grains- You should also include brown rice and oats in your diet to keep the skin healthy. This helps in reducing hair loss and breakage of hair. Our skin also benefits from it. 




5- Garlic- Garlic helps in making the skin clean and free from pimples. Garlic acts as a natural antibiotic that helps in purifying blood. Garlic also strengthens the immune system. Garlic also helps in repairing skin tissue.


6- Curd and oatmeal- You should also include foods rich in vitamin B in your diet yogurt and oats. Vitamin B is very important to maintain moisture in the skin. You must consume curd for this.


7- Oily fish- Fish is considered to be a good source of Omega 3 fatty acids. Also, walnuts and flax seeds contain Omega 3 fatty acids. Omega-3 fatty acid helps to keep the skin supple and free from wrinkles. This keeps the skin hydrated. 


8- Egg- Eggs are considered a superfood for health. Eggs contain vitamin B7 that relieves skin problems and also gives freedom from the problem of breaking of nails. Eggs give the body good amounts of iron, protein, and zinc. 




9- Citrus fruits and berries- You must include citrus fruits and berries in the diet to keep the skin healthy. Citrus fruits give vitamin C to the body and berries help in increasing the amount of collagen in the body. Collagen helps in keeping the skin soft and supple. Antioxidants present in berries also prevent the aging of the skin.


10- Orange coloured vegetables- Orange coloured vegetables are very beneficial for skin and eyes. You must include red-yellow bell peppers, carrots, and beetroot in your diet. They are rich in vitamin A, which is essential for the prevention of wrinkles.
